Comment capability at Data Tables record level
You can access comment capability at record level to enable seamless collaboration between customers using table for storing structured data such as Timesheet, Client Billings, Asset Repositories etc.
- All data tables created within a project will have comment capability available at every record level. Once a user adds a title to a record, indicating it is an active record, the comment icon gets active. User can click on the Comment icon next to each record in the data table or can open the record and user can navigate to the Comments section by clicking on the comment icon to add their comment.
- Anyone with whom a project has been shared can view and add comments.
- In case a record in a data table is assigned to a client, then the client will get an option to add or view comments from their client portal.
- When a comment is added by a user, it will get updated in the Comments tab and appear in the shortcut widget on the Home tab. User can click the hyperlink to quickly navigate to the Comment section.
NOTE:
Client contacts cannot comment in table view.
Add comments to a data table record
-
Click on the Project that you have created.

-
Select an existing project or create a data table. In these instructions, we selected an existing project and navigate to the already created data table view.
-
To create a new table, you can select the ’+’ icon or choose from the available templates.

-
Navigate to Employee Onboarding, then click on existing record or add a new record by providing the necessary details.

-
To view or add a new comment, click on the comment icon available in the first column and it will redirect to the comments section of a selected project.

-
Users can also open the record and navigate to the comments section in the right- side drawer.

-
You can add a comment at the record level and click the Comment button. Users can also view and edit comments next to each record in the data table by clicking on the three- dot icon.

-
After the comment has been posted, it will automatically get updated in the Comments tab, allowing users to view comments, access hyperlinks and navigate to the comment section by clicking on it.

The functionality mentioned above also ensures that users have visibility to any conversation and collaboration taking place at the project level or a record level in the data table. The hyperlinks help users keep track of the context of the comments made in the project.
NOTE:
Users who are part of a project can access both the data table and the comments section.
